Position: Employee Success Partner - Full Time
Location:  Based in Westfield, MA; Bloomfield, CT; or Ledyard, CT based upon candidates geographic location (Requires regular travel among Viability programs and office sites.)

Schedule: Monday - Friday 8:00am-4:30pm 

Summary: 

Are you someone who enjoys helping others navigate challenges, build confidence, and succeed in their careers? We are looking for an Employee Success Partner (ESP) to serve as a trusted and confidential resource for our staff. The Employee Success Partner provides individualized employment coaching and support to help employees successfully navigate their workplace experience. This position serves as a skilled, neutral resource for staff, directors, and teams, helping promote positive, productive, and healthy employment experiences. The ESP works with employees to identify concerns, explore solutions, navigate workplace policies and procedures, identify professional development opportunities, and connect them with additional resources when needed.

Duties and Responsibilities: 
  • Provide confidential, individual coaching to employees as they navigate workplace challenges and concerns.
  • Help employees identify, understand, and work through workplace issues in a constructive and productive manner.
  • Support employees in developing strategies for effective problem-solving and issue resolution.
  • Provide a neutral, supportive space where employees can talk through workplace experiences and concerns.
  • Help employees identify opportunities for professional development, career growth, and internal advancement or relocation within Viability.
  • Assist employees in identifying their skills, strengths, interests, preferences, and professional goals.
  • Recommend training, professional development, and skill-building opportunities based on individual goals.
  • Identify and share internal and external opportunities for professional growth and development.
  • Assist employees in understanding and navigating agency policies and procedures related to workplace concerns.
  • Support employees in developing and understanding their professional brand.
  • Help them to prepare for and understand performance evaluations.
  • Assist in building effective relationships with supervisors and leaders.
  • Help navigate team dynamics and workplace relationships.
  • Support employees in processing and responding to negative feedback.
  • Provide understanding and ways of navigating disciplinary actions.
  • Help employees determine when additional support or intervention may be appropriate.
Required Qualifications: 
  •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Counseling, Industrial/Organizational Psychology, or a related field preferred. An equivalent combination of education and relevant experience will be considered.
  • 3–4 years of experience in human resources, employee relations, coaching, counseling, or a related human services field required.
  • Strong ability to maintain confidentiality and exercise sound, impartial judgment when handling sensitive or complex situations.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Strong active-listening, coaching, problem-solving, and conflict-resolution skills.
  • Ability to build trust and rapport with employees at all levels of an organization.
  • Ability to remain neutral and supportive when navigating workplace concerns.
  • Strong understanding of workplace dynamics, employee relations, and professional development.
  • Experience working in the Human Services industry preferred.
